Do you have anything like Kool Scarves? A cloth scarf filled with polymer crystals that absorb water when you soak it and when you put it around your neck it functions as an evaporative cooler. It makes an amazing difference. They're only $12 at REI. I have a couple of them in the van And my earthquake/wildfire evac kit. They really do work and they are low tech if your electronic doodad isn't available.
